Malyavan’s Counsel, Portents in Laṅkā, and the Proposal of Alliance
काळिकाःपाण्डुरैर्दन्तै: प्रहसन्त्यग्रतःस्थिताः ।स्त्रियस्स्वप्नेषुमुष्ण्नत्योगृहाणिप्रतिभाष्यच ।।।।
kāḷikāḥ pāṇḍurair dantaiḥ prahasanti agrataḥ sthitāḥ | striyaḥ svapneṣu muṣṇantyo gṛhāṇi pratibhāṣya ca ||
Em sonhos, mulheres negras como carvão, de dentes pálidos, ficam diante de nós rindo alto; proferem palavras de mau agouro e parecem saquear as próprias casas — sinal funesto.
"Women of dark colour like coal with yellow teeth are speaking unpleasant things standing before us in dreams laughing heartily."
A ruler’s dharma is vigilance: when signs indicate disorder, one must examine one’s own wrongdoing and restore righteousness rather than ignore warnings.
Disturbing dream-visions are reported as portents foretelling danger to Laṅkā and its households.
